On the heels of an American Bar Association commission vote to permit nonlawyers to hold a minority ownership role in law firms, Jacoby & Meyers on Friday fired a broadside at a New York court rule barring firms from accepting outside investments.

The firm’s memorandum, which was submitted to the U.S. District Court for the Southern District of New York, comes in response to a motion filed earlier this summer by Attorney General Eric T. Schneiderman.
